CA burning coolant

my 86 rx7 non turbo is burning lots of coolant and has a loss of compression, i'm planing of rebuilding the motor. How hard is it to rebuild? i have rebuild many reciprocating motors but never a rotary. Any tips before i start my rebuild?

I must say though that you should pull the motor apart asap instead of letting it sit. Coolant inside the engine corrodes the plating of the housing iirc
